Jonathan Zittrain – Minds for Sale
Harvard Law Professor, Jonathan Zittrain, on ethical considerations of creating value through crowdsourcing/using mass participation:
Companies, government, and other agencies can disguise farmed-out work as games or other mediums. What happens when we spend hours a week on platforms like Mechanical Turk and we don’t know what the data is being used for? What happens on the other end when we use data from these sources to inform us?
